Signs are often organized as
codes governed by explicit
and implicit rules agreed upon
by members of a culture or
social group. A system of
signs may thus carry
encoded meanings and
messages that can be read by
those who understand the
codes. A signifying structure
composed of signs and codes
is a text that can be read for
its signs and encoded
meanings.
